性能優化王道就是給更多資源!機器更多了,CPU更多了,內存更多了,性能和速度上的提升,是顯而易見的。基本上,在一定范圍之內,增加資源與性能的提升,是成正比的;寫完了一個復雜的spark作業之后, 進行性能調優的時候,首先第一步,我覺得,就是要來調節最優的資源配置;在這個基礎之上 ...
Spark性能調優之資源分配 性能優化王道就是給更多資源 機器更多了,CPU更多了,內存更多了,性能和速度上的提升,是顯而易見的。基本上,在一定范圍之內,增加資源與性能的提升,是成正比的 寫完了一個復雜的spark作業之后, 進行性能調優的時候,首先第一步,我覺得,就是要來調節最優的資源配置 在這個基礎之上, 如果說你的spark作業, 能夠分配的資源達到了你的能力范圍的頂端之后,無法再分配更多 ...
2017-03-11 00:37 0 6484 推薦指數:
性能優化王道就是給更多資源!機器更多了,CPU更多了,內存更多了,性能和速度上的提升,是顯而易見的。基本上,在一定范圍之內,增加資源與性能的提升,是成正比的;寫完了一個復雜的spark作業之后, 進行性能調優的時候,首先第一步,我覺得,就是要來調節最優的資源配置;在這個基礎之上 ...
參考:https://www.cnblogs.com/ITtangtang/p/7683028.html ...
在開發完Spark作業之后,就該為作業配置合適的資源了。Spark的資源參數,基本都可以在spark-submit命令中作為參數設置。很多Spark初學者,通常不知道該設置哪些必要的參數,以及如何設置這些參數,最后就只能胡亂設置,甚至壓根兒不設置。資源參數設置的不合理,可能會導致 ...
不同,任務可以按照權重來決定執行順序。 資源分配概述 spark的分配資源主要就 ...
spark動態資源調整其實也就是說的executor數目支持動態增減,動態增減是根據spark應用的實際負載情況來決定。 開啟動態資源調整需要(on yarn情況下) 1.將spark.dynamicAllocation.enabled設置為true。意思就是啟動動態資源功能 2. ...
跑spark程序的時候,公司服務器需要排隊等資源,參考一些設置,之前不知道,跑的很慢,懂得設置之后簡直直接起飛。 簡單粗暴上設置代碼: 一小部分設置。簡單解析一下: 1、spark.shuffle.service.enabled。用來設置是否開啟動態分配。開啟了動態分配 ...
1、spark匯聚失敗 出錯原因,hive默認配置中parquet和動態分區設置太小 2.hive數據入hbase報錯 出現報錯原因: executor_memory和dirver_memory太小,在增大內存后還會出現連接超時的報錯 解決連接超時 ...
本課主題 大數據性能調優的本質 Spark 性能調優要點分析 Spark 資源使用原理流程 Spark 資源調優最佳實戰 Spark 更高性能的算子 引言 我們談大數據性能調優,到底在談什么,它的本質是什么,以及 Spark 在性能調優部份的要點,這兩點 ...